DURING the Commencement Weekend and ensuing Reunion Week, the College will be host at three luncheons at which President Dickey and prominent members of the Dartmouth alumni body will speak.
The traditional Commencement Luncheon will take place on Saturday, June 13, in Alumni Gymnasium. President Dickey will preside and other speakers will be Joseph W. Worthen '09, representing the Fifty Year Class; Sidney C. Hayward '26, Secretary of the College; and an officer of the graduating class to be named this month.
Francis Brown '25, vice president of the General Alumni Association, will preside at the speaking program to follow an Alumni Luncheon in Thayer Hall on Tuesday, June 16. President Dickey and Mr. Hayward will address the alumni.
The second and larger Alumni Luncheon will take place in Alumni Gymnasium on Saturday, June 20. The presiding officer will be William C. Embry '34, president of the General Alumni Association. A special feature will be the presentation of the annual Alumni Awards by Clarence V. Opper '18, president of the Dartmouth Alumni Council. President Dickey and Mr. Hayward will again be speakers.
The Classes of 1889, 1894, 1899, 1904 and 1909 will be back for reunions over Commencement Weekend. The Classes of 1919, 1923, 1924 and '1925 return for the Monday through Wednesday period, June 15-17; and reunions during the rest of the week will be held by 1934, 1943, 1944, 1945 and 1949.
Hanover Holiday will be held during Reunion Week, with faculty lectures Monday through Saturday. An innovation will be two seminars, conducted by the Departments of Economics and English.
